The answer to 'why is my smoke detector not working' is that there are several common causes, including a dead or disconnected battery, a malfunctioning sensor, or a problem with the electrical wiring. Smoke detectors are essential safety devices, so it's important to troubleshoot and resolve any issues promptly.
Some of the most common symptoms of a non-working smoke detector include the detector not chirping or lighting up when tested, the battery being completely drained, or the detector simply not responding to smoke or test triggers. To resolve the issue, you'll want to first check the battery and replace it if needed. If that doesn't fix the problem, you may need to clean the detector or replace the entire unit.
